计算机组成概要
1.CPU(处理器)
N种寄存器: 存储计算的指令/数据
2.总线 :连接功能单元/运输数据
4.Cache :缓存:存储常用数据
5.DRAM(主存) : 存储易失性数据
6.辅存 :长期保存数据
运行原理
计算机是一种类似黑箱的数据处理机器,本质是数据运算
那么,一次简单的运算是如何开始的呢?
从某处获得数据 :通常是外部世界, 再不断层级传输(通过总线)到CPU最后到相应位置
→辅存 :硬盘等
→DRAM :短时间存储运算数据
→寄存器 :分解本次运算,不同的寄存器存储不同的"运算"(有些保存数据, 有些保存操作)
→CPU :在基本周期中,从寄存器获得指令("数据", "操作")进行运算,返回结果,进行下一条指令
→相关位置。
1.数据通过总线传输
2.常用数据/操作由Cache存储 :节省时间